    ‘Bionic Man’ – England captain Ben Stokes gives update after hamstring surgery

    England Take a look at captain Ben Stokes has dubbed himself “Bionic Man” after present process his newest hamstring operation.

    Stokes tore his left hamstring throughout England’s remaining sport of 2024 in New Zealand, requiring surgical procedure and a three-month lay-off from aggressive cricket.

    He took to Instagram to verify he had gone beneath the knife, posting an image of him sprawled on the again seat of a automotive supported by a big leg brace and pillows.

    Within the captions he wrote “Bionic Man for some time” accompanied by a laughing emoji and signed off “in a bit…”.

    Stokes missed 4 consecutive Take a look at matches after tearing the identical hamstring whereas enjoying within the Hundred final August.

    He labored by an intense interval of rehabilitation and seemed to be again to full health as he resumed all-rounder duties with bat and ball towards the Black Caps.

    However his elevated workload caught up with him within the remaining Take a look at at Hamilton, the place he left the sector after pulling up mid-over and was unable to play any additional half within the match.

    Stokes had already been omitted from England’s squad for subsequent month’s Champions Trophy and, with no Take a look at matches till Could, has time on his aspect as he appears to get again to peak situation.

    Talking after sustaining the damage he promised: “I ain’t holding again. Each setback, I come again stronger. There’s little doubt I’ll be going away from right here… and getting myself again to the place I used to be. That’s my job.”
